• Using a Zoom Lens
Use
the
zoom
ring
to
zoom
in
on
the
subject
so
that
it
fills a
larger area
of
the
frame,
or
zoom
out
to
increase
the
area
visible in
the
final
photograph
(select
longer
focal
lengths
on
the
lens focal
length
scale
to
zoom in, shorter focal
lengths
to
zoom
out)
.
To save
battery
power
when
the
flash
is
not
in use,
return
it
to
its
closed
position
by
pressing
it
gently
downward
till
the
latch clicks
into
place.

• The Built-in Flash
If
additional
lighting
is
required
for
correct exposure in
~
mode,
the
built-in
flash
will
pop
up
automatically
when
the
shutter-release
button
is
pressed halfway.
If
the
flash
is
raised,
photographs
can
only
be taken
when
the
flash-ready
indicator
(~)
is
displayed.
If
the
flash-
ready
indicator
is
not
displayed,
the
flash
is
charging;
remove
your
finger
briefly
from
the
shutter-release
button
and
try
again.

Auto
Meter-Off
The
viewfinder
and
information
display will
turn
off
if
no
operations are
performed
for
about
8 seconds (auto
meter-off),
reducing
the
drain
on
the
battery.
Press
the
shutter-release
button
halfway
to
reactivate
the
display. The
auto
meter-off
delay can be selected using
Custom Setting c2
(Auto
off
timers;
CD
11).

• Image Sensor Cleaning
The camera vibrates
the
low-pass
filter
covering
the
image
sensor
to
remove
dust
when
the
camera
is
turned
on
or
off.
